CEMcaptain’s measurement and digital capabilities help increase onboard safety, provide process optimisation and reduce ownership costs. By consistently achieving at least 98% more uptime, the new system not only requires less maintenance but also saves time otherwise spent on handling non-compliance issues.

“CEMcaptain has been combined with innovations in on-site and remote digital services,” said Stephen Gibbons, ABB’s head of product management in continuous gas analysers. “The result is a solution that provides the industry with a digital toolbox that increases regulatory compliance and operational efficiency,” he added.

CEMcaptain is a multi-component analyser system that continuously provides real-time data. It integrates analyser modules and sample handling components in a standalone cabinet, making installation easy.

Equipped with ABB’s Uras26 non-dispersive IR gas analyser, CEMcaptain measures sulphur dioxide and carbon dioxide with each analyser having two separate gas paths to allow for continuous measurement of separate streams, with up to four different components per module.

Diagnostic information can be collected from the analyser via a scanned code and transferred to ABB support. ABB Ability Remote Assistance with secured connectivity direct to ABB support is also available for real-time solutions.

CEMcaptain GAA610-M is approved by DNV GL, ABS, Lloyd’s Register, Bureau Veritas, ClassNK and Korean Register.
